+## Datastore management
+
+Datastores are used by the media repository to put files. Typically these match what is configured in the config file, such as s3 and directories. 
+
+#### Listing available datastores
+
+URL: `GET /_matrix/media/unstable/admin/datastores?access_token=your_access_token`
+
+The result will be something like: 
+```json
+{
+  "00be9363007feb66de554a79e16b7b49": {
+    "type": "file",
+    "uri": "/mnt/media"
+  },
+  "2e17bad1bf76c9618e3cde30166dc674": {
+    "type": "s3",
+    "uri": "s3:\/\/example.org\/bucket-name"
+  }
+}
+```
+
+In the above response, `00be9363007feb66de554a79e16b7b49` and `2e17bad1bf76c9618e3cde30166dc674` are datastore IDs.
+
+#### Estimating size of a datastore
+
+URL: `GET /_matrix/media/unstable/admin/datastores/<datastore id>/size_estimate?access_token=your_access_token`
+
+Sample response:
+```json
+{
+  "thumbnails_affected": 672,
+  "thumbnail_hashes_affected": 598,
+  "thumbnail_bytes": 49087657,
+  "media_affected": 372,
+  "media_hashes_affected": 346,
+  "media_bytes": 340907359,
+  "total_hashes_affected": 779,
+  "total_bytes": 366601489
+}
+```
+
+#### Transferring media between datastores
+
+URL: `POST /_matrix/media/unstable/admin/datastores/<source datastore id>/transfer_to/<destination datastore id>?access_token=your_access_token`
+
+The response is the estimated amount of data being transferred:
+```json
+{
+  "thumbnails_affected": 672,
+  "thumbnail_hashes_affected": 598,
+  "thumbnail_bytes": 49087657,
+  "media_affected": 372,
+  "media_hashes_affected": 346,
+  "media_bytes": 340907359,
+  "total_hashes_affected": 779,
+  "total_bytes": 366601489
+}
+```
